Abstract

mecanismo regulador ativado por fluido em uma válvula a presente iinvenção refere-se a um mecanismo regulador (1) ativado por fluido em uma válvula , especialmente uma válvula de bloqueio de segurança ou de regulagem que abrange uma unidade básica (2) apresentando válvulas de comando , dois atuadores lineares (6,7,) , reciprocamente opostos, ativáveis fluidicamente através das válvulas de comando , bem com um transformador (5) mecânico disposto entre dois atuadores lineares acoplando os seus cursores, sendo que a saída do transformador está acoplada com a entrada da armação . no caso , o mecanismo regulador é construído em forma de módulos de componentes individuais unidos para compor uma unidade funcional na forma da unidade básica dos dois atuadores básicos e do transformador mecânico.
